Is BEONx or Rate Quantum Better for Hotels?

Both BEONx and Rate Quantum aim to optimize revenue but approach this goal differently. BEONx offers a comprehensive, AI-driven platform with automation, multi-property management, and strategic tools like the Hotel Quality Index™. Rate Quantum, on the other hand, focuses on demand-based, multiple daily rate adjustments without referencing competitors. While BEONx emphasizes strategic automation and broad functionalities, Rate Quantum stands out for its demand-driven, flexible approach. How Much Do BEONx and Rate Quantum Cost?

BEONx's pricing starts at $800/month, reflecting its extensive feature set and enterprise capabilities. Rate Quantum is priced at $300/month, emphasizing affordability and demand-based rate adjustments without long-term contracts. While BEONx’s higher price offers more functionality, Rate Quantum’s lower cost makes it attractive for smaller properties or those on a tight budget.

Rate Quantum vs BEONx: The Bottom Line for Hotels

The core difference is that BEONx offers an extensive, AI-driven platform designed for hotels seeking automation, strategic insights, and multi-property management. Rate Quantum provides a simplified, demand-focused approach that adjusts rates multiple times daily based on your property’s demand, without relying on competitor data.

If your hotel needs a comprehensive solution with automation, forecasts, and integrations, go with BEONx. Its broad features and proven track record justify the higher price point, especially for larger or chain hotels aiming to maximize profitability.

If your hotel prefers a straightforward, demand-driven system that’s easy to implement and cost-effective, Rate Quantum fits better. Its focus on real-time demand patterns and affordability make it ideal for boutique hotels or properties with minimal tech staff.

In summary, choose BEONx if you want a full-scale, strategic revenue management system with extensive capabilities. Opt for Rate Quantum if you need a simple, flexible, and affordable solution that responds directly to your demand patterns.

Increase Revenue & Reduce Costs
BEONx HotelAtelier Small
+ BEONx's Hotel Quality Index (HQI) enabled Hotelatelier's revenue management team to quantify their own quality as well as their competitors' quality and combine it with competitors' pricing. This provided the team with deeper insights into the market, allowing them to correctly identify their target group's willingness to pay for the quality they offer.
+ By relying on the HQI to identify guests' willingness to pay, Hotelatelier was able to establish a pricing strategy in line with customer expectations. This ensured that guests' expectations of quality matched with the price, which helped to create a sustainable base of loyal guests.
+ Utilizing the HQI empowered Hotelatelier's revenue management team with deep market insights and data-driven decision-making. The team was able to analyze their new offer compared to the competition, understand exactly what their target group would be willing to pay for the quality they offer, and make more informed pricing decisions that were in line with customer expectations. This increased revenue management efficiency and helped to establish the ICON brand long-term.

Where hoteliers push back

Event and compset management 78% negative

Several users express a need for improved responsiveness to special events and dynamic compset integration. Enhancements like automated event replicat... Several users express a need for improved responsiveness to special events and dynamic compset integration. Enhancements like automated event replication and AI-driven compset calculations are requested to better model demand.

Historical data retention 100% negative

There are some concerns about the deletion of pricing data after 90 days, limiting historical analysis. Users suggest retaining this data longer to en... There are some concerns about the deletion of pricing data after 90 days, limiting historical analysis. Users suggest retaining this data longer to enhance strategic insights over extended periods.

How Does HTR Evaluate and Rank BEONx and Rate Quantum?

The HT Score is a composite ranking that considers 4 criteria groups and over a dozen variables to help hoteliers objectively compare hotel technology products. BEONx has an HT Score of 85 and Rate Quantum has 0. Here is how the score is calculated.

Criteria Group Weight What It Measures
Customer Ratings & Reviews

How highly do users recommend this product?

Ratings Score, Review Volume, Share of Voice, Review Depth, Review Recency, Success Stories

The most heavily weighted factor. Analyzes average satisfaction ratings (likelihood to recommend, ease of use, support, ROI), total review count relative to category peers, review recency (at least 20 reviews in the trailing 6 months), and share of voice across unique hotel clients to detect selection bias.

Partner Ecosystem

How highly do tech partners recommend this company?

Partner Recommendations, Integration Quantity, Integration Quality

Evaluates partner recommendations as expert votes of confidence, the number of verified integrations, and ecosystem quality — the average HT Scores of integration partners. Products with higher-quality integration ecosystems are more likely to deliver a connected tech stack.

Customer Centricity

How customer-centric is this organization?

Certified Support, Review Consistency, Profile Completeness

Assesses whether the company has earned HTR Customer Support Certification, maintains consistent review collection over time (an indicator of feedback-driven culture), and keeps product profiles complete with capabilities, screenshots, pricing, and features.

Reach, Staying Power & Resources

How extensive is this company's reach and resourcing?

Geographic Reach, Staying Power, Company Resources, Trending Score

Measures global presence (countries and regions served), years in business as a stability proxy, team headcount as a resource proxy, and a trending score based on trailing-twelve-month buyer inquiries, reviews, partner recommendations, and press activity.

Customer ratings and reviews are by far the most important factor in the HT Score algorithm. HTR does not accept payment for higher rankings. All reviews are verified — only hotel industry practitioners with confirmed affiliations can submit ratings. View full HT Score methodology →
